Son

AJ White 1966 (Maryland)



When I say, "I love you son".
With understanding I hope you hear me
The breath and depth
Of the words I've uttered
The feelings of me
I've dared to share with you
My son
Time has been taken
On you to reflect
From the moment I knew
The existence of you
Until now and continued counting of minutes
Our walk through time together
Moments
Both bad and good
With pain and joy
You'll always be 'My boy'
Now a Man
Just me and my thoughts of you down memory lane
Frequently walk
To have seen and seeing you grow
Has and does well my heart
Arriving at:
I'll always
Love You My Son
